Wi-Fi in the road? Kansas City tech start-up is wiring pavement for safety — and fun

“Self-driving cars have captured the limelight when it comes to how you’ll get around in the future, but one Kansas City technology start-up is looking at the road itself.

Integrated Roadways is developing “smart pavement” technology that would not only help increase roadway safety but could also serve as the platform for Wi-Fi for cars and other future mobility services.

“Smart pavement is a factory-produced pavement system that transforms the road into a sensor, data and connectivity network for next-generation vehicles,” said Tim Sylvester, founder, chief executive and president of Integrated Roadways.

The road system uses high resolution fiber optic sensors and other technologies inside the pavement to detect vehicle position in real time as well as roadway conditions. This technology would detect crashes as they occur, for instance, and automatically notify emergency responders to those crashes…”
